Guardiola brings up 1,000 games as a manager Arne Slot unhappy with Van Dijk's disallowed goal Pep Guardiola praised J r my Doku and thanked Manchester City for giving him the "incredible present" of a 3-0 victory over Liverpool in his 1,000th match as a manager. First-half goals from Erling Haaland and Nico Gonz lez and an outstanding 20-yard individual Doku effort after the break took City to within four points of Premier League leaders Arsenal. The Sean Dyche era is fully up and running at Nottingham Forest after securing his first Premier League win as head coach. Leeds were barely worthy opponents, which is concerning considering the two teams could face a long battle for survival. Lukas Nmecha put Leeds ahead but they quickly withdrew their challenge as Ibrahim Sangar , Morgan Gibbs-White and Elliot Anderson secured Forest a first Premier League victory in 10 matches to move them one point off 17th.
